I'm interested in running Haskell code invoked from an Apache web server request. I discovered the mod_haskell project [1] which looks prima facie v. promising. Does anyone have any recent experience of using this (there apparently being no recent activity on this project)?
If you're using GHC, I don't think a mod_haskell is a feasible option right now, since Haskell code can't be compiled to a dynamic library (unless you statically compile in mod_haskell into Apache, which is pretty unusual these days, or you're on Mac OS X which supports dynamic libraries, but then you're treading on pretty new ground). You're probably best off with a standalone CGI program. -- % Andre Pang : trust.in.love.to.save http://www.algorithm.com.au/
